// To Customize
const baseUrl = "http://yourUrl.com"
const user = "yourName"
const passwort = "yourPassword"
const months = ["Januar", "Februar", "März", "April", "Mai", "Juni", "Juli", "August", "September", "Oktober", "November", "Dezember"]
const targetValues = [] // your target values in Wh for each month as array with length 12
const maxPower // your maximum power output in W
// Constants for the skript, DONT CHANGE!
const lineWeight = 2;
const targetLineWeight = .5
const targetLineColor = Color.green()
const currentLineColor = Color.yellow()
const summedLineColor = Color.orange()
const verticalLineColor = Color.gray()
const font = Font.mediumSystemFont(26)
const hourFont = Font.systemFont(20)
const widgetHeight = 338
const widgetWidth = 720
const graphLow = 280
const graphHeight = 160
let spaceBetweenPoints
let drawContext = new DrawContext();
drawContext.size = new Size(widgetWidth, widgetHeight);
drawContext.opaque = false;
let widget = await createWidget()
widget.setPadding(0, 0, 0, 0)
widget.backgroundImage = (drawContext.getImage())
await widget.presentMedium()
Script.setWidget(widget)
Script.complete()
async function createWidget(items) {
let req = new Request(getDayRequestUrl(false) + "&token=" + await getJWT())
let json = await req.loadJSON()
if (json.total == undefined) {
const errorList = new ListWidget()
errorList.addText('Keine Ergebnisse gefunden.')
return errorList
} else {
const values = json.values
const list = new ListWidget()
const date = new Date()
let gesKwh = Math.round(json.total / 10) / 100
let reachedTarget = Math.round((json.total / targetValues[date.getMonth()]) * 100)
drawContext.setFont(font)
drawContext.setTextColor(Color.gray())
drawContext.drawText('☀️ Froniview'.toUpperCase()
+ ' | '
+ date.getDate() + ". "
+ months[date.getMonth()] + " "
+ date.getFullYear()
+ ' | '
+ gesKwh + " kWh ≈ "
+ reachedTarget + " %"
, new Point(25, 25))
drawContext.setTextAlignedCenter()
// Target Line
let targetPoint1 = new Point(50, graphLow - (graphHeight * 0.5))
let targetPoint2 = new Point(670, graphLow - (graphHeight * 0.5))
drawLine(targetPoint1, targetPoint2, targetLineWeight, targetLineColor)
spaceBetweenPoints = 620 / await getYesterdayValueNumber()
for (let i = 0; i < json.values.length - 1; i++) {
let timestamp = new Date(json.values[i].timestamp)
if (timestamp.getMinutes() == 0) {
drawHourLine(timestamp, i, json.values[i].value / maxPower)
}
// Summed line
let summedX1 = spaceBetweenPoints * i + 50
let summedY1 = json.values[i].sum_of_values / (targetValues[date.getMonth()] * 2)
let summedX2 = spaceBetweenPoints * (i + 1) + 50
let summedY2 = json.values[i + 1].sum_of_values / (targetValues[date.getMonth()] * 2)
let summedPoint1 = new Point(summedX1, graphLow - (graphHeight * summedY1))
let summedPoint2 = new Point(summedX2, graphLow - (graphHeight * summedY2))
drawLine(summedPoint1, summedPoint2, lineWeight, summedLineColor)
// Current production value
let x1 = spaceBetweenPoints * i + 50
let y1 = json.values[i].value / maxPower
let x2 = spaceBetweenPoints * (i + 1) + 50
let y2 = json.values[i + 1].value / maxPower
let point1 = new Point(x1, graphLow - (graphHeight * y1))
let point2 = new Point(x2, graphLow - (graphHeight * y2))
drawLine(point1, point2, lineWeight, currentLineColor)
}
let heighestValue = getHeighestValue(json.values)
drawContext.setFont(font)
drawContext.setTextColor(Color.orange())
drawContext.drawText(new String(
Math.round(heighestValue[0] / 10) / 100 + " kW"
).toString(),
new Point(
spaceBetweenPoints * heighestValue[1] + 20,
graphLow - (graphHeight * (heighestValue[0] / maxPower) + 30)))
return list;
}
}
function drawHourLine(timestamp, i, y) {
let x = spaceBetweenPoints * i + 50
let point1 = new Point(x, graphLow - (graphHeight * y))
let point2 = new Point(x, graphLow)
drawContext.setTextColor(verticalLineColor)
drawContext.setFont(hourFont)
drawContext.drawText(timestamp.getHours() + " h" , new Point(x - 15, graphLow + 10))
drawLine(point1, point2, targetLineWeight, verticalLineColor)
}
function getHeighestValue(values) {
let res = 0
let pos = 0
for (let i = 0; i < values.length; i++) {
if (values[i].value > res) {
res = values[i].value
pos = i
}
}
return [res, pos]
}
async function getJWT() {
let req = new Request(baseUrl + "/user/login?mail=" + user + "&password=" + passwort)
req.method = 'POST'
let json = await req.loadJSON()
return json.token
}
function getDayRequestUrl(yesterday) {
let date = new Date()
if (yesterday) {
date.setDate(date.getDate() - 1)
}
let res = baseUrl + "/day?day=" + date.getDate() + "&month=" + (date.getMonth() + 1) + "&year=" + date.getFullYear()
return res
}
async function getYesterdayValueNumber() {
let req = new Request(getDayRequestUrl(true) + "&token=" + await getJWT())
let json = await req.loadJSON()
if (json.values == undefined) {
return undefined
} else {
return json.values.length
}
}
function drawLine(point1, point2, width, color) {
const path = new Path()
path.move(point1)
path.addLine(point2)
drawContext.addPath(path)
drawContext.setStrokeColor(color)
drawContext.setLineWidth(width)
drawContext.strokePath()
}
